Candidates try to win over undecided voters

THE tight race between John McCain and Mitt Romney added emphasis to the need to persuade undecided voters and encourage hard-core supporters to turn out today.

Mr Romney scheduled six events, an end-of-the-day rally and a two-minute television ad, while Mr McCain pushed into what he called ‘The Mac Is Back’ bus tour, flanked by dozens of friends and relatives who turned out for the final New Hampshire push.

Optimism mixed with nostalgia as the Arizona senator sought a repeat of his surprise win here during his first White House run eight years ago.
